4.0 out of 5 stars A great help to a real beginer!, February 14, 2001
By A Customer
This review is from: Home Decor for Beginners (Coats & Clark) (Spiral-bound)
This book guided me step by step through many projects. Every step is explained in words and pictures, which made it very easy to follow along. I also found the knowing the parts of the machine section in the beginning of the book very helpful. At the end of each project several variations are suggested and explained. Some requiring greater skills, but still achievable ones by the average beginner. My only complaint was that after completing the duvet cover project and making a coordinating flanged pillow set, I realized that the book did not include instructions on making the bed skirt. The photograph that introduces the duvet cover project shows a bed skirt - I think a good addition to the book would be bed skirt instructions. This would allow the beginner to complete a bed redecorate project in the same easy to follow instruction manual.

5.0 out of 5 stars A Must Have for the Do-It-Yourself Decorator!, November 5, 2002
By 
Sandra H. Rosser (Fayetteville, NC United States)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Home Decor for Beginners (Coats & Clark) (Spiral-bound)
As someone who returned to sewing after a 20 year absence, I found this book a wonderful way to "jump start" into projects. The instructions were clear and the illustrations made each project a "never fail" project. Also, there are dozens of tips and sewing term explanations throughout the book that were helpful as well. Coats & Clark even suggests the different fabrics you can use for each project which was a plus for me. I've completed all but one project from the book and get raves from people who see my handiwork. There are so many DIY projects and suggestions for decorating your home in this one book, it was well worth buying.

4.0 out of 5 stars Nice, but not what I was looking for, May 2, 2004
By 
Kim Callahan (Springfield, MO)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Home Decor for Beginners (Coats & Clark) (Spiral-bound)
I gave the book four stars even though I have decided to not keep it. For those wanting to try some easy beginning home decorating projects this book has several popular examples such as roman shades and decorator pillows. However, this book ended up not being what I was looking for. I was looking for something with a little more instruction for total beginners like myself and almost all the designs rely on a sewing machine, which I don't own.
